Minor Surface Repairs

Minor imperfections such as sanding scratches, pinholes or small dents should be repaired before applying the final primer system.

StepDescription
CleanWash surface thoroughly to remove dirt, wax, grease and contamination.
SandSand damaged area using P80 – P120 grit abrasive to expose solid substrate.
FillApply fairing compound or filler to repair surface.
Sand SmoothAfter cure, sand with P120 – P220 to restore smooth profile.
PrimeApply 545 Epoxy Primer or recommended primer system.

Recommended Repair Fillers

  • Awlfair LW (Lightweight fairing compound)
  • Awlfair FL (Flexible fairing compound)
  • Awlfair Surfacing Filler

Fairing Large Areas

Fairing compounds are used to correct hull distortions, repair structural areas, and create smooth surfaces prior to applying primer systems.

StepDescription
Prepare SubstrateSand or blast surface to proper mechanical profile.
PrimeApply corrosion protection primer such as Hullgard Extra or Max Cor CF.
Apply Fairing CompoundApply Awlfair compound to level surface.
ShapeSand with P36 – P80 to establish surface contour.
Final SandSand with P120 – P180 before primer.
PrimeApply 545 Epoxy Primer before topcoat system.

Recommended Fairing Compounds

  • Awlfair LW – lightweight fairing compound
  • Awlfair FL – flexible fairing compound for vibration areas
  • Awlfair Surfacing Filler – finishing filler

Sprayable Fairing Systems

Sprayable fairing compounds allow rapid fairing of large areas such as hull sides and superstructures.

StepDescription
Prepare SurfaceSand or blast substrate to required profile.
PrimeApply corrosion protection primer.
Apply Spray FairingApply epoxy sprayable fairing compound.
Block SandSand fairing with longboard using P80 – P120.
Final PrimerApply High Build or Ultra Build epoxy surfacing primer.
UndercoatApply 545 Epoxy Primer before topcoat.

Typical System

Primer → Spray Fairing Compound → High Build Primer → 545 Epoxy Primer → Awlgrip Topcoat

Important: Fairing compounds should only be applied over properly prepared and primed surfaces. Applying fairing directly to bare metal substrates is not recommended without proper corrosion protection primers.
